Transaction f89c97341f835f219ab357b91eed96e41a3b9f95e34ae4da615dc3a343f68015

2 Input
2 Outputs
  • f89c97341f835f219ab357b91eed96e41a3b9f95e34ae4da615dc3a343f68015:0
  • value  23623
    address  1HnG6m1e83oCQkwBRkGEHGxXBqFCWTg6oT
  • f89c97341f835f219ab357b91eed96e41a3b9f95e34ae4da615dc3a343f68015:1
  • value  5702219
    address  12ck7EEe2RptHGABLY3KV2kMpkgpbeVZYY